Print-ready artwork is a clear, reviewable instruction set for the finished product. It helps prepress identify trim, colour, images, fonts, and finishing requirements before a job enters production. Project specifications remain the authority: dimensions, file settings, layers, and proof expectations vary with the product and process.
Prepare the file early, then preflight it again after every late change. A polished layout can still produce avoidable questions if an image is linked incorrectly, a spot colour is unnamed, or a dieline is mixed into printable artwork. The aim is a dependable hand-off with enough context to review the work intelligently.
Build the PDF around the finished product
Start with the agreed trim size, orientation, page count, and reading order. Export single pages or spreads only as requested for the product; a booklet, a folded piece, and a bound book can need different delivery conventions. Include intentional blank pages, check that covers are separate when required, and keep the source document with its linked assets until the job is complete.
Check effective resolution at placed size
Effective resolution is determined by the image data in relation to its final placed dimensions. An image can look convincing on a screen and still lose detail when enlarged in the layout. Inspect the exported PDF as well as the working file, looking for soft imagery, unexpected crops, compression artifacts, or a placed image that was scaled beyond its useful detail. Use the project guidance for the required resolution rather than a remembered setting from another job.
Where an image crosses a fold, spine, die-cut, or trim, review the composition in the final product context. A subject placed safely in a flat layout may be interrupted once the item is constructed. Flag any deliberately close crop for proof review so it is judged against the selected binding or fold instead of only against the screen layout.
Common starting points—job specification overrides
| Prepress item | Common starting point | What the job specification decides |
|---|---|---|
| PDF delivery | Use a controlled PDF export; PDF/X variants are common delivery standards. | The requested PDF/X variant, page convention, output intent, and any supplied preset. |
| Bleed | Three millimetres is a common example for a trimmed printed item. | The required bleed and safe area for the actual format, fold, binding, or finishing. |
| Images | Check effective PPI at final placed size. | The required resolution and any exception for the chosen process or product. |
| Colour and black | Use process and spot colours deliberately; use vector artwork where possible for logos and small type. | The profile, spot-colour naming, black build, and proof method accepted for the job. |
For example, a 3,000-pixel-wide image placed at 10 inches wide has an effective resolution of 300 PPI: 3,000 ÷ 10 = 300. If the same file is placed at 15 inches, it becomes 200 PPI. This is a planning calculation, not a universal acceptance threshold; the project specification and intended viewing distance decide whether that result is suitable.
When RGB artwork is converted to CMYK, use the profile and conversion path requested for the job and inspect the resulting PDF rather than assuming colours will translate unchanged. Keep logos and very small type as vectors when possible so they remain defined at output. For black text, 100K is often used for small type; large rich-black areas may use a different build, but only the agreed production specification should determine it.
Set colour with an agreed intent
Use the requested CMYK workflow for process-colour artwork. When a design depends on a spot colour, name it consistently and keep it distinct from process content. A screen preview is not a production proof: paper, ink, coating, lighting, print method, and finishing all influence appearance. The useful instruction is what must be reviewed and against which approved reference.
Flag brand-critical colours, large solids, fine reversed type, and the images that carry the greatest importance. If an approved physical sample or colour reference exists, supply it with the brief and state its purpose. Protect trim, bleed, and safe areas
Bleed extends backgrounds or images beyond final trim so normal cutting variation does not leave an unintended edge. Safe areas protect essential type, logos, and fine details from trim, folds, holes, and binding. Use the dimensions supplied for the finished product rather than copying them from an unrelated file.
For cartons, shaped cards, pockets, or special folds, use the supplied dieline rather than recreating it. Keep it on the agreed non-printing layer or spot-colour convention and separate it from the printable design. Check every panel for text or image elements that cross a fold, spine, punch, or cut path. Control type, transparency, and overprint
Embed fonts or convert them only when the agreed workflow calls for it, then inspect the final PDF for substitution or reflow. Small type, thin rules, reversed copy, and text over images deserve close attention because they are more sensitive than a large headline. Keep the final text proof separate from a visual colour review so each approval question is clear.
Transparency, blend modes, knockouts, and overprint can be intentional but should be checked in the exported PDF. An overprint setting that gives one object a desired result can make another disappear or combine unexpectedly. Use output-preview tools where available and identify anything unusual in the hand-off. This includes metallic effects, varnish, white ink, or other finishing layers that must be produced independently from the ordinary artwork.
Keep the production PDF distinct from working proofs that contain comments, guides, or alternative concepts. Remove accidental hidden objects, unused swatches, review notes, and obsolete layers before export, while preserving the agreed production layers that prepress needs. Open the final exported file in a separate viewer. This catches stale links and export settings that may not be obvious inside the design application.
Separate finishing instructions from printable art
Only include a dieline, white ink, foil, emboss, varnish, or other finishing layer when the product specification calls for it. Name the layer according to the project convention and make its relationship to the visible design clear. Do not invent extra production marks in a final PDF. A short note identifying the intended effect and the pages it affects is more useful than relying on a reviewer to infer it from a complex file.
Preflight the final export, not just the source
- Confirm final trim, orientation, page count, pagination, bleed, and safe areas.
- Inspect effective image resolution and crops at the final placed size.
- Review CMYK, spot colours, black builds, and colour-critical pages.
- Verify fonts, transparency, overprint, folds, dielines, and finishing layers.
- Compare the PDF with the written specification before the release is approved.
Preflight works best as a sequence. First check the document structure, then inspect output warnings, then review representative pages visually, and finally compare the exported PDF with the job brief. A second person can focus on page order, live text, and unexpected objects while the designer checks colour intent and layout. Record the version that passed so a later edit triggers a targeted repeat of the same checks.
For a multi-page job, make a page-by-page exception list rather than relying on memory. Note pages with a special fold, a different stock, a critical image, a finishing layer, or a language version. The list helps the approver concentrate on real risks and gives production a concise explanation of why those pages deserve additional attention during preflight and proof review.
Do a final filename check as well. The file name should distinguish the approved production version from drafts without making a promise about an unverified method, date, or outcome. Match the named file to the quote, product specification, and approval record. If anything changes after release, issue a clear replacement and state exactly which prior file it supersedes.
Release files with production context
Send the final PDF together with the product specification, quantity, named approver, proofing request, and delivery requirements. Tell production about anything deliberately unusual: a special ink, die-cut, fold, insert, versioned file, or finishing layer.
